Understanding Your Options: Natural Sod vs. Artificial Turf
The first major decision in a lawn replacement project is choosing between natural grass and synthetic alternatives. Each has distinct characteristics in terms of appearance, feel, maintenance, and long-term investment.
Natural sod provides the classic look and feel of a real grass lawn. It involves installing rolls or slabs of pre-grown grass that include soil and a root system. The primary advantage is its authentic appearance and natural cooling effect. However, it requires a consistent commitment to watering, mowing, fertilizing, and seasonal care to thrive in New Jersey's climate.
Artificial turf, or synthetic grass, offers a consistently green, low-maintenance surface. Modern versions are highly realistic in look and texture. While the initial cost is higher, it eliminates watering, mowing, and chemical treatments, potentially saving significant time and money over many years. It's an excellent solution for shady areas, steep slopes, or high-traffic zones where natural grass struggles.
The Critical First Step: Site Preparation
Regardless of the material chosen, proper site preparation is the non-negotiable foundation for a durable and attractive lawn. Skipping or skimping on this phase is the leading cause of lawn failure, drainage issues, and uneven surfaces down the line 1 2.
Removing the Old Lawn
The existing grass, weeds, and debris must be completely removed. This can be done through sod cutting, tilling, or using herbicides, followed by thorough clearing. Professionally, this process typically costs between $0.88 to $1.84 per square foot in the East Orange area 1.
Grading and Leveling the Soil
This is perhaps the most important preparatory step. The ground must be contoured to ensure water drains away from your home's foundation to prevent basement flooding and structural damage. Experts recommend a minimum slope of 1 inch per foot for the first 10 feet from the foundation 1. Rough grading (shaping the subsoil) averages $1 to $2 per square foot, while fine grading (creating a smooth top layer) costs about $0.40 to $1 per square foot 3. For many yards, the combined grading and leveling cost falls in the range of $1.25 to $4 per square foot, depending heavily on the existing terrain's condition 4.
Addressing Drainage
Poor drainage leads to soggy lawns, disease, and dead grass. For natural sod, good drainage is achieved through proper grading and amending the soil. For artificial turf, a stable, permeable base is constructed, typically using 3-4 inches of compacted crushed gravel or decomposed granite, topped with a weed barrier fabric 1. If significant water issues exist, additional systems like French drains or catch basins may be necessary, adding hundreds to thousands of dollars to the project cost 5.
Soil Amendments for Natural Sod
Before laying sod, the soil should be tested. Based on the results, it may need amendments like compost, lime, or starter fertilizer to create the ideal pH and nutrient-rich environment for grass roots to establish quickly and strongly 1.
Permit Considerations
Most municipalities, including East Orange, require a grading permit for any significant excavation or land disturbance. Permit fees can range from $50 to $400, and your local provider should be able to advise on or handle this requirement 6.
Cost Breakdown for East Orange Homeowners
Costs for lawn installation vary based on yard size, accessibility, material quality, and the extent of preparatory work needed. Here's a detailed look at what homeowners can expect.
Material and Installation Costs (Per Square Foot):
- Natural Sod Installation: $1 - $6 per square foot installed. While the sod rolls themselves may cost less than $1 per square foot, professional installation includes delivery, labor, site prep, and guarantees, which account for the higher total cost 7 8.
- Artificial Turf Installation: $5 - $20 per square foot installed. This wide range reflects differences in turf quality (pile height, density, face weight), the complexity of the installation (curves, slopes, intricate cuts), and the quality of the base materials 1 9 10.
Project-Scale Estimates: For a typical 500 square foot yard:
- A new sod lawn might cost between $500 and $3,000.
- An artificial turf installation for the same area could range from $2,750 to $9,375 (or more for premium products).
These estimates often exclude major, separate grading or drainage projects. The initial investment for synthetic grass is substantially higher, but long-term savings on water bills, lawn care equipment, and maintenance services can offset this over 5-10 years 9 7.

Installation Timelines and Seasonal Timing
Understanding the project schedule helps set realistic expectations for when you can enjoy your new outdoor space.
Natural Sod:
- Installation Duration: Most residential sod installations are completed within 1 to 3 days.
- Ready for Use: The sod can tolerate light foot traffic after about 2 weeks, once the roots have begun to knit into the soil. It is generally considered fully established and ready for regular activity (like play or entertaining) after 6 to 8 weeks of proper watering 11 12.
- Optimal Season: In New Jersey, the best times to lay sod are during the cooler, moist periods of late summer and early fall. This allows the grass to establish strong roots without the extreme heat stress of summer. Spring is also a good window, provided consistent watering is maintained 13.
Artificial Turf:
- Installation Duration: A straightforward installation can often be completed in 1 day. More complex projects with significant grading or custom designs may take up to a week.
- Ready for Use: The area is immediately usable upon completion of the installation.
- Optimal Season: One of the key advantages of synthetic grass is that it can be installed year-round, in almost any weather condition 1 14.
Choosing a Local Provider for Your Project
Selecting the right professional is crucial. Look for providers with specific, verifiable experience in the type of lawn installation you desire. For sod, expertise in soil science and local grass varieties is important. For artificial turf, ask about the specific materials they use for the base and backing, as these are critical for longevity and drainage. Always review portfolios of past work, check for proper licensing and insurance, and read customer reviews. A reputable professional will conduct a thorough site evaluation, provide a detailed written estimate that breaks down all costs (prep, materials, labor, disposal), and clearly explain the installation process and warranty.
Long-Term Care and Maintenance
Your responsibilities change dramatically based on your choice.
Caring for a New Sod Lawn: The first few weeks are critical. It requires deep, frequent watering to prevent the seams from drying out. After establishment, a routine of regular mowing, seasonal fertilization, aeration, and overseeding will be necessary to keep it healthy through New Jersey's winters and summers.
Maintaining Artificial Turf: Maintenance is minimal but essential. It involves periodic rinsing to remove dust and pollen, brushing the fibers to keep them upright, and promptly removing leaves or debris. Unlike natural grass, it will not require watering, mowing, or chemical treatments.
